Quinte school students create radio ads to promote drinking water protection - Ground Water Canada
Quinte, Ont. – Local Grade 4 to 8 students have created radio advertisements aimed at protecting drinking water in a competition that will see the winning ad recorded professionally along with a class field trip to Belleville’s Gerry O’Connor Water Treatment Plant and a pizza lunch for the contest winners. Winners of Drinking Water Protection Radio Contest
The following was submitted by Quinte Conservation: Around 200 local students turned up the volume with creative radio ads, calling for the protection of our drinking water—all part of this year’s Drinking Water Protection Radio Contest.
